What is the land like in Ukraine?

Ukraine's landscape is varied, featuring plains, plateaus, and mountains. The country has fertile black soil regions known as the "chernozem," which support agriculture. Additionally, Ukraine has forests, rivers, and a coastline along the Black Sea.


Does Ukraine have a Savannah a grassland a desert rivers and mountains?

Ukraine has grasslands and some low-lying plains, but not savannahs or deserts. It is known for its rivers such as the Dnieper and mountains like the Carpathians in the west.
